WebThe BEST way to stretch your hamstrings is to remove your back/spine from the equation entirely so you cannot compensate with it during the stretch. Try this: Lie flat on your back with a belt in your hands (any belt). Raise one leg straight up (not to the side) and hook the belt around the ball of your foot (the higher up on the foot, the better). Before I continue, I would like to say I am not an expert, and these are merely exercises that I have compiled after reading ... in 1991 high in the mountainsWebJan 17, 2024 · The blue belt rank requires two years of consistent training. The purple belt takes three to five years to achieve. It takes five to six years to achieve the rank of brown belt. The black belt takes six to ten years of consistent training on average.
